QU is an album[1]. QU ranks in the top 2% of album ent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(9 views/month).[2]
Key Facts
- QU's instance of is recorded as album[3].
- QU's genre is rock music[4].
- QU followed Not Gonna Love EP[5].
- QU was followed by Some Things Never Leave You[6].
- QU was produced by Brad Wood[7].
- QU was performed by Sherwood[8].
- QU's record label is recorded as MySpace Records[9].
- QU was released on 2009[10].
